Demand and Seasonality
Understanding demand is crucial for securing a great rental price. High-demand periods, such as holidays and major events, often result in higher prices. Conversely, periods of lower demand, like weekdays in the off-season, tend to offer more affordable options. This dynamic is a recurring theme in many industries, not just car rentals. Consider booking well in advance to maximize your chances of finding a favorable rate.
Special Offers and Promotions
Budget car rental companies frequently offer special deals and promotions. These can range from discounts for specific booking windows to loyalty rewards programs. Staying updated on these offers is key to finding attractive rates. Often, checking websites and social media accounts of rental companies can reveal these deals.
Fuel Prices
Fuel prices have a direct impact on rental costs. As fuel prices rise, rental companies often adjust their rates accordingly. This is because higher fuel costs translate into higher operating expenses for the rental company. In some cases, the rental price might include fuel, while in others, you’ll be responsible for fuel surcharges, which can significantly affect the total cost.
Booking in Advance
Booking in advance is often a key strategy for securing the best price. Companies often have different pricing tiers based on the lead time of the booking. The longer the lead time, the greater the chance of finding a more competitive rate. Planning ahead allows you to compare rates and secure a deal that suits your budget.
This is especially true for popular travel periods.

Comparing Prices and Options
Rental companies often offer different packages and vehicles, and prices can fluctuate dramatically. Failing to compare prices from various providers could mean missing out on significant savings. A crucial step is researching different rental companies, checking their websites, and contacting them directly for quotes. This proactive approach can reveal hidden discounts and tailored packages that might not be readily apparent.
Reading Reviews and Understanding Terms, Budget car rental san bernardino ca
Before signing on the dotted line, it’s wise to delve into customer reviews. Past experiences offer valuable insights into the company’s service quality, vehicle condition, and overall customer support. Furthermore, thoroughly reviewing the rental agreement’s terms and conditions is vital. This step helps clarify any hidden fees, mileage restrictions, or other potential costs. Knowing the fine print can prevent unpleasant surprises later.
Considering Insurance and Additional Options
Rental insurance policies vary considerably, and the default coverage might not meet your needs. Consider adding supplemental insurance, especially if you’re driving in an area with unique risks or have specific travel requirements. Also, evaluate add-ons like GPS systems, child seats, or extra drivers. These seemingly small extras can significantly impact your overall rental cost.
Making Informed Decisions: A Checklist
To streamline your selection process, consider this checklist:
- Compare prices from multiple rental companies.
- Read customer reviews and check for any red flags.
- Carefully review all terms and conditions, paying close attention to hidden fees.
- Understand the insurance options and any additional coverage you might need.
- Evaluate add-ons like GPS, child seats, or extra drivers.
- Check for special offers or discounts.
- Confirm vehicle availability and pick-up/return procedures.
This structured approach ensures a more informed decision and can help prevent potential issues down the road.
